Economy & Jobs
The median household income in North Fort Myers is $55,696, 26% below the national average of $75,149. The job market is very strong with unemployment at just 1.4%. 9.0% of residents live in poverty, near the national average of 12.4%. Workers commute an average of 26 minutes.
Cost of Living & Housing
The median home value in North Fort Myers is $137,700, 51% below the national median / off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$1,155 per month. At just 2.5x median income, home prices are very affordable relative to local earnings.
Safety & Crime
With 1,103 violent crimes per 100,000 residents, public safety is a notable concern / this is significantly above the national average of 380. Property crime occurs at a rate of 3,121 per 100,000, 59% above the national average.
Education
20.7%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 90.2% have completed high school. Area schools have an average test score of 5.7/10.
Climate & Weather
North Fort Myers has a warm climate with an average annual temperature of 75°F. Winters average 65°F in January while summers reach 83°F in July. With 330 sunny days per year, residents enjoy well above the national average of sunshine. Annual precipitation totals 57.4 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.
North Fort Myers has a population of 44,189 with a density of 895 people per square mile, spread across 49.4 square miles. The median age is 63.7 years, 64% older than the national median of 38.9. The gender split is 52.1% female and 47.9% male. The city is predominantly White (87.8%), with 1.2% Black. English is the primary language spoken at home by 89.3% of residents, while 10.7% speak Spanish. 13.5% of the population are veterans, above the national rate of 6.0%. 21.6% of residents have a disability (above the 13.0% national average). 88.7% have health insurance coverage.

The median household income in North Fort Myers is $55,696, which is 26% below the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$36,868. The average weekly wage is $1,184, 17% lower than the U.S. average. The unemployment rate is 1.4% (below the 3.6% US average). 9.0% of residents live below the poverty line, lower than the national rate of 12.4%. The area has 28,954 business establishments, including 1,636 restaurants. The cost of living index is 103.4, roughly in line with the national average. Workers commute an average of 26 minutes. 11.6% of workers work from home (below the 15.2% national rate).

The median home value in North Fort Myers is $137,700, 51%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home value at $264,902, higher than the Census estimate. Homes sell for 94.9% of their list price, suggesting buyers have room to negotiate. Monthly rent averages $1,155 (1% below the national average of $1,163). Fair market rent ranges from $1,296 for a one-bedroom to $1,526 for a two-bedroom apartment. 85.8% of housing units are owner-occupied (above the 65.4% national rate). There are 28,175 total housing units in the city. The median year a home was built is 1985. The average annual property tax is $9,664 (higher than the $3,500 national average). 32.4% of renters spend 30% or more of their income on housing. The home price-to-income ratio is 2.5x, well within the affordable range.

In North Fort Myers, 31.8% of adults are obese, below the national rate of 32.1%. 10.8% have diabetes. Heart disease affects 6.3% of residents. 31.6% have high blood pressure. 15.7% are current smokers. 18.0% report binge drinking. 25.3% are physically inactive. 20.8% report depression. 19.1% experience frequent mental distress. 15.6% of residents lack health insurance (above the 8.6% national rate). The primary care physician ratio is 1:1,504. The dentist ratio is 1:1,886. 85.3% of residents have access to exercise opportunities. The food environment index is 7.5 out of 10.

North Fort Myers has a violent crime rate of 1,103 per 100,000 residents, 190% above the national average of 380. Property crime stands at 3,121 per 100,000, 59% above the U.S. average. The county recorded 128 fatal traffic crashes. The area has experienced 91 federally declared disasters. Overall, North Fort Myers receives a safety grade of F.

North Fort Myers has a warm climate with an average annual temperature of 75°F (24°C). Winters average 65°F in January while summers reach 83°F in July / relatively mild seasonal variation. The area gets 330 sunny days per year, well above the U.S. average of 205 / making it one of the sunnier locations in the country. Annual precipitation totals 57.4 inches (wetter than the 38-inch national average).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41. The city sits at an elevation of 13 feet, near sea level.
